在二维码(QR-code)中,标准所采用的纠错码是Reed-Solomon码(以下简称RS码) 一串原始信息所产生的RS码长度是可以自定义的,但是RS码越长,纠错效果越佳。我们设 RS(n,k) 表示一串长为 n 的编码,其中前 k 位是原始信息,其余位置是原始信息产生的RS码 RS码为一串编码提供了互相推出的可能性,具体地说,对于一串...
Error Correction Codingwww.thonky.com/qr-code-tutorial/error-correction-coding 以下内容是对上面资料内容的一个总结,对所有作者表示感谢。 RS编码解码的过程直接借用参考1的图: 有限域 Reed-Solomon编码的数学是定义在有限域(Finite Field)之上的,有限域的运算是可以硬件实现的,而且成本不很高。 RS编码 RS编码...
Zero latency, low gate count, low power, asynchronous Reed Solomon Code based Erasure code for RAID FEC: The whole operation of encoding and decoding ...
为程序员写的Reed-Solomon码解释 Reed-Solomon纠错码(以下简称RS码)广泛用于数据存储(如CD)和传输应用中。然而,在这些应用中,码字是藏在了电子设备里,所以无法一窥它们的模样以及它们是如何生效的。有些复杂的条形码设计也采用了RS码,能够暴露出所有的细节,对于想要获得这种技术如何生效的第一手技术的爱好者,这是一...
广义reedsolomon码是一种非常有效的数据传输方式,它可以在存在噪声的环境中实现可靠的数据传输。广义reedsolomon码的历史与发展 广义reedsolomon码是由reed和solomon在20世纪60年代提出的,它是一种可以纠正多个错误的线性分组码。随着技术的发展,广义reedsolomon码得到了广泛的应用,它被广泛应用于卫星通信、磁记录、光纤...
The Reed-Solomon Encoder LogiCORE™ module is a high speed, compact design that implements many different Reed-Solomon coding standards including G.709, DVB, ATSC, IEES, ITU-T J.83 and CCSDS. The core is fully synchronous, using a single clock, and supports continuous output data with no...
Reed-Solomon编码(又叫RS编码、里德-所罗门编码)作为一种前向纠错编码,是一种很常见的数据冗余技术,也就是通过对数据增加冗余部分来保证当数据丢失时能够在一定程度上进行恢复。最典型的应用就是在现在最流行的QR二维码的编码设计中。 实现功能 他所解决的问题是:给定n个数据块(d1,d2,d3,...,dn),对于一个确...
If you need to store or transmit data, and be able to recover it if some is lost, you might want to look at Reed-Solomon coding. Using our code is an easy way to get started. About Brian Beach Brian has been writing software for three decades at HP Labs, Silicon Graphics, Netscape...
Symbol reconstruction methods by applying Galois Field arithmetic to Reed Solomon codewords have been disclosed. Reconstruction methods by applying n-valued reversing logic functions are also provided. A correct codeword can be selected from calculated codewords by comparing a calculated codeword with ...
Reed-Solomon code RS码纠错能力还不错,比较出名的应用有NASA率先使用的卫星、深空通信,SONY的CD等。需要一点Golais Field的数学知识。由于实现起来有点难度,以前只能照着书本的公式理解,最终写出来代码其实也不长,但重新设计一个也是耗费脑筋。也因为略有困难的原因,开源代码不多,似乎这是FEC/ECC领域内心照不宣的...